Cette propriété spécifie l'alignement vertical des éléments HTML.
| vertical-align | |
|---|---|
| Valeur | baseline sub super top text-top middle bottom text-bottom Longueur Pourcentage |
| Valeur par défaut | baseline |
| Domaine d'application | Les éléments en-ligne et les cellules de tableau. |
| Pourcentage | En référence à la hauteur de la ligne de l'élément lui-même. |
| Héritage | non |
| Media | Visuel |
| Valeur possible |
Action | Exemple |
|---|---|---|
| baseline | Alignement sur la base de la ligne. | div {vertical-align: baseline} |
| middle | Alignement au milieu de la base de la ligne. | p {vertical-align: middle} |
| sub | Alignement en bas de la ligne de base. | blockquote {vertical-align: sub} |
| super | Alignement au-dessus de la ligne de base. | em {vertical-align: super} |
| text-top | Alignement en haut de la boite de l'élément. | caption {vertical-align: text-top} |
| text-bottom | Alignement en bas de la boîte de l'élément. | table {vertical-align: text-bottom} |
| top | Alignement en haut de la boite de l'élément avec le haut de la boîte de la ligne. | td {vertical-align: top} |
| bottom | Alignement en bas de la boîte de l'élément avec le bas de la boîte de la ligne. | input {vertical-align: bottom} |
| Longueur |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| textarea {vertical-align: 1.7em} |
| Pourcentage |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| th {vertical-align: 120%} |
| Alignement sur la base de la ligne. | td {
vertical-align: baseline
} |
| Alignement au milieu de la base de la ligne. | td {
vertical-align: middle
} |
| Alignement en bas de la ligne de base. | td {
vertical-align: sub
} |
| Alignement au-dessus de la ligne de base. | td {
vertical-align: super
} |
| Alignement en haut de la boite de l'élément. | td {
vertical-align: text-top
} |
| Alignement en bas de la boîte de l'élément. | td {
vertical-align: text-bottom
} |
| Alignement en haut de la boite de l'élément avec le haut de la boîte de la ligne. | td {
vertical-align: top
} |
| Alignement en bas de la boîte de l'élément avec le bas de la boîte de la ligne. | td {
vertical-align: bottom
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 1.7em
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 1em
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 5em
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 120%
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 20%
} |
| Alignement au-dessus (valeur positive) ou en-dessous (valeur négative) de la ligne de base. | td {
vertical-align: 180%
} |
td {
vertical-align: top;
text-align: left
} |
|
td {
vertical-align: middle;
text-align: right
} |
|
td {
vertical-align: bottom;
text-align: center
} |
| Windows | Macintosh | ||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| NE4 | NE6 | NE7 | IE5 | IE55 | IE6 | OP5 | OP6 | OP7 | NE4 | NE6 | NE7 | IE4 | IE5 |